Technical Field
The utility model relates to the technical field of rewinding machines, in particular to a clean type slitting rewinding machine for papermaking.
Background
A slitting rewinder is a main device for producing cash register paper, and is a machine which cuts and arranges the base paper with large width and large diameter by fixed width, and then rewinds the base paper into finished paper rolls with uniform inside and outside.
The rewinding machine that cuts now, the paper roll raw materials and the paper powder of cutting back paper tape surface can't be clear away, causes personnel when using the paper tape, and the paper powder that adheres to the paper tape surface probably flies to inhaled internal problem by the user, experience relatively poor when leading to the user to use.

Example 1
As shown in fig. 1, this embodiment provides a rewinding machine is cut with clean type to papermaking, including workstation 1, workstation 1 upper end fixedly connected with installation piece 2 and mounting panel 3, and 2 internal rotations of installation piece are connected with the paper discharge roller 4, and 3 internal rotations of mounting panel are connected with tensioning roller 5, first paper collection roller 6 and second paper collection roller 7, and 3 upper ends fixedly connected with backup pad 8 of mounting panel, 8 lower extremes fixedly connected with dust extraction of backup pad
Example 2
As shown in figure 1, based on the same concept as that of the above embodiment 1, the embodiment also proposes that the right end of the installation is fixedly connected with a first motor 9 through a motor box, and the shaft outlet end of the motor is fixedly connected with the paper discharge roller 4
In this embodiment, the paper discharge roller 4 is driven by the first motor 9 to rotate, and the roll paper is conveyed forward.
Example 3
As shown in fig. 1 to 3, based on the same concept as that of the above embodiment 1, the present embodiment further provides that a connecting shaft 10 is rotatably connected in the mounting plate 3, a circumferential surface of the connecting shaft 10 is fixedly connected with a cutting blade 11, a second motor 12 is fixedly connected at the right end of the mounting plate 3 through a motor box, and an output shaft end of the second motor 12 is fixedly connected with the connecting shaft 10
In this embodiment, drive connecting axle 10 through starting second motor 12 and rotate, connecting axle 10 drives cutting piece 11 and rotates, and cutting piece 11 will cut through the stock form of tensioning roller 5 department, reaches the effect of cutting apart the stock form.
Example 4
As shown in fig. 3, based on the same concept as that of the above embodiment 1, the embodiment further proposes that a connecting wheel 13 is fixedly connected to the circumferential surface of the connecting shaft 10, a linkage shaft 14 is rotatably connected to the mounting plate 3, a cutting groove 15 is formed in the circumferential surface of the connecting shaft 10, and the linkage shaft 14 is rotatably connected to the connecting wheel 13
In the embodiment, the connecting wheel 13 fixedly connected with the circumferential surface of the connecting shaft 10 is attached to the linkage shaft 14 for friction, the connecting shaft 10 drives the linkage shaft 14 to rotate, the roll paper is conveyed forwards on the circumferential surface of the tensioning roller 5 in an auxiliary mode, meanwhile, the cutting blade 11 fixedly connected with the circumferential surface of the rotating shaft is located in the cutting groove 15 formed in the circumferential surface of the linkage shaft 14, and when the roll paper is cut, the roll paper can be cut completely.
Example 5
As shown in fig. 3 to 4, based on the same concept as that of embodiment 1, the present embodiment further provides that the dust suction device includes a fixing block 16, a dust suction box 17, a dust suction pipe 18 and an exhaust fan 19, the fixing block 16 is fixedly connected to the lower end of the supporting plate 8, the dust suction box 17 is fixedly connected to the lower end of the fixing block 16, the dust suction pipe 18 is fixedly connected to the rear end of the dust suction box 17, the exhaust fan 19 is fixedly connected to the circumferential surface of the dust suction pipe 18, and the exhaust fan 19 is fixedly connected to the supporting plate 8 through a connecting column
In this embodiment, the fixed block 16 fixes the dust collection box 17 at the cutting position of the roll paper, the suction fan 19 generates suction in the dust collection pipe 18 by starting the suction fan 19, and paper dust generated when the roll paper is cut is collected by the dust collection box 17 and then discharged in the water storage box 20 through the dust collection pipe 18, so that the paper dust is reduced from adhering to the paper surface.
Example 6
As shown in fig. 4, based on the same concept as that of embodiment 3, the present embodiment further provides a water storage box 20 fixedly connected to the upper end of the supporting plate 8, a sliding slot 21 is formed in the inner wall of the water storage box 20, a sliding table 22 is slidably connected to the sliding slot 21, a baffle plate 23 is fixedly connected to the sliding table 22, a first filter screen 24 and a second filter screen 25 are fixedly connected to the baffle plate 23, the first filter screen 24 is located below the second filter screen 25
In this embodiment, when the paper powder is sucked into the water storage box 20, the baffle 23 is used for blocking the paper powder, the first filter screen 24 is used for isolating the paper powder, the water pump 26 is nearby, the generated suction force can block the first filter screen 24, at this time, the water circulates through the second filter screen 25, and when the water needs to be cleaned, the baffle 23 only needs to be pulled out.
Example 7
As shown in fig. 4, based on the same concept as that of the above embodiment 6, this embodiment further proposes that a water pump 26 is fixedly connected in the water storage box 20, a water pipe 27 is fixedly connected at the upper end of the water pump 26, a nozzle 28 is fixedly connected at the upper end of the water storage box 20, and a nozzle 28 is fixedly connected at one end of the water pipe 27 far away from the water pump 26
In this embodiment, water is pumped into the water pipe 27 by starting the water pump 26, and then water is sprayed into the water storage box 20 through the nozzle 28, so that paper powder sucked into the water storage box 20 by the dust suction pipe 18 is wetted, thereby facilitating subsequent treatment.
Example 8
As shown in fig. 5 to 6, based on the same concept as that of embodiment 1, the present embodiment further proposes that a first gear 29 is fixedly connected to the left end of the connecting shaft 10, a reduction gear 32 and a second gear 30 are fixedly connected to the right end of the first wind-up roller 6, a third gear 31 is fixedly connected to the right end of the second wind-up roller 7, the first gear 29 is connected to the reduction gear 32 through a first chain 33, and the second gear 30 is connected to the ground third gear through a second chain 24
In this embodiment, drive connecting axle 10 through the motor and rotate, first connecting axle 10 drives first gear 29 and rotates, and first gear 29 drives reducing gear 32 and rotates, and reducing gear 32 drives second receipts paper roll 7 and rotates, and second receipts paper roll 7 drives second gear 30 and rotates, and second gear 30 drives third gear 31 and rotates, and third gear 31 drives second receipts paper roll 7 and rotates, has reached the collection effect to the stock form after cutting.
The working principle of the utility model is as follows: when the utility model is used, the first motor 9 drives the paper discharge roller 4 to rotate by starting the first motor 9, the second motor 12, the exhaust fan 19 and the water pump 26, the second motor 12 drives the rotating shaft and the cutting blade 11 to rotate, the rotating shaft drives the linkage shaft 14 to rotate by the rotating cylinder, the cutting blade 11 cuts the roll paper passing through the space between the tension roller 5 and the linkage shaft 14, the rotating shaft drives the speed reduction wheel 32 to rotate by the first gear 29 and the first chain 33, the speed reduction wheel 32 drives the first paper collection roller 6 to rotate, the first paper collection roller 6 drives the second paper collection roller 7 to rotate by the second gear 30 and the second chain wheel, the cut roll paper is collected, the paper powder generated when the paper powder is cut firstly enters the dust collection box 17 by the suction force generated by the exhaust fan 19, then enters the water storage box 20 by the dust collection box 17 and the dust collection pipe 18, at the moment, the spray head 28 above the water storage box 20 passes through the water pump 26 and the water pipe 27, the water in the water storage tank is sprayed to the paper powder entering the water storage box 20, the paper powder is soaked in the water and falls into the water, the water pump 26 is fixedly connected in front of the first filter screen fixed in the baffle 23, the paper powder is possibly attached to the first filter screen 24 by suction force generated by the water pump 26, and the circulation of the water in the water tank is ensured by the existence of the second filter screen 25.
